About Tea In Ehime Prefecture
Ehime Prefecture is located in the northwestern part of the Shikoku region. It is characterized by rugged mountainous terrain, epitomized by Mount Ishizuchi—the highest peak in western Japan—and has very few flat plains.
“Shingu Tea” from Shikokuchuo City and “Kuma Tea” from Kuma Kogen Town are renowned for their high quality as sencha.
Additionally, “Ishizuchi Black Tea,” a rare fermented tea with a tradition dating back to the Edo period, was designated as an Important Intangible Folk Cultural Property of Japan in 2023.
